Re: Typical Customer Data Usage

average usage might be tough to calculate without filters like age group and such. you have your gamers, movie watcher, youtubers, download junkies, house holds with multiple devices.

I am not a bit torrent user but I still average 500GB+ per month and that is due to having a large house hold with multiple devices and people doing various things like gaming, watching youtubes, pandora, updating said games and downloading games when steam has crazy sales, web surfing, various updates to computers; software; devices, etc.

I don't think I could survive on 250GB per month and let alone 10GB. probably why i don't own a smart phone. those dinky data plans just beg the customer to go over.
